Output 99a3efbc5463f62a9867578ea324bc412c5e91078e7bd49797926b98e0d47791:1

value
59993761
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50d4806efee73c5c8b3e322aed3eca2954870d36 OP_EQUALVERIFY OP_CHECKSIG
address
18NPdDw29bs1FDd9aWdLyGoW2XFWDopuVx
transaction
99a3efbc5463f62a9867578ea324bc412c5e91078e7bd49797926b98e0d47791
spent
true